*March 31*

Humility is a gift of the Fifth Step.

Some of us might struggle with arrogance, but for many, the real issue is a poor self-image. We either see ourselves as better than others or, more often, worse.

It’s easy to feel like we don’t measure up. But when we open up—sharing our experiences with another person and with our Higher Power—we start to see the truth: We’re not as different as we thought. It’s humbling, sometimes surprising, but always comforting to realize how much we have in common with others.

The person who listens to our Fifth Step will help us see this. Learning to accept ourselves as equals to those around us might feel unfamiliar, but this step is part of our growth. The more we commit to the process, the more we’ll appreciate just how powerful it is.

Today’s Affirmation:

I am who I am, much like all the other people around me. And that’s good. I’ll appreciate it today.
